Transaction dd0a8cff41eafd860f234b39133f3e8d954286bf71d46af3197264171f9a24b6
1 Input
1 Output
-
dd0a8cff41eafd860f234b39133f3e8d954286bf71d46af3197264171f9a24b6:0
- value
- 149986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5832881c5379ab19087e247e42b142c37ec1700 OP_EQUAL
- address
- 3M9xySK5b9YZhaWURv86p1CKBi2nRqN34g